Center direction cv.jit.directions

Qbrick's icon

I used the example from jit.directions and underneath is a whole subpatch that has the mecanics, this goes to a another subpatch with 'p draw' as name. This arrow shows the direction.
But is it possible to have the arrow change in to a circle when the direction is non or no direction.
The actual arrow doesn't need to change actually, but the centered or non direction needs to be registered. Is this possible and where do I need to look at to change this in the cv.jit.direction object?

Max Patch
Copy patch and select New From Clipboard in Max.